I have a preamp that uses 6x4. I did a lot of tube rolling. Going by the names on the bottles, I tried Tung-Sol, Mullard, Amperex, etc... I found, to my surprise (while the differences weren't huge such as a new GZ34 vs. a Mullard), that my favorite was the cheap and plentiful RCA black plates. Enough of a difference that I noticed, not enough that I truly worry about it. These are not expensive tubes so finding out for yourself is an easy proposition.
